description | 【Objective】The Volvariella brumalis He sp.nav. is a unique low-temperature mushroom in China. The optimal conditions for the fermentation culture of liquid strains of V. brumalis were investigated, aiming to reduce the production time and costs of V. brumalis strains, and promote the standardized and large-scale production of V. brumalis.【Method】The optimal growth conditions of liquid fermentation culture of V. brumalis were studied from the aspects of carbon sources and nitrogen sources, temperature, pH, and inoculation amount. A four-factor and three-level orthogonal test was conducted to determine the best fermentation formula.【Result】The result showed that the optimal carbon source for liquid fermentation culture of V. brumalis was glucose. And the dry masses of the mycelial bulb was 1.35 g/L. The optimal nitrogen source was fermented soybean meal powder, and the dry masses of the mycelial bulb was 3.76 g/L. Suitable carbon sources (glucose, fructose) and nitrogen sources (fermented soybean meal powder, fermented corn pulp) were selected to establish L9 (34) orthogonal table for four-factor and three-level orthogonal tests to obtain the optimal formula for fermentation culture: glucose 20.0 g, fructose 10.0 g, fermented soybean meal powder 2.5 g, fermented corn syrup 2.5 g, KH2PO4 1 g, K2HPO4 0.5 g, MgSO4·7H2O 0.5 g, vitamin B1 10 mg, pH of 6-7, H2O 1000 mL. The mycelial bulb dry mass reached 5.79 g/L with this formula, and the inoculation amount was 3% when cultured at 18 ℃ and 120 r/min for 15 d. Other culture conditions were explored with an optimized formulation, obtaining an optimum temperature of 18℃, a mycelial bulb dry mass of 5.97 g/L, and an appropriate pH from 6 to 7. And when the inoculation amount reached 7%, the dry mass of the mycelial bulb was 6.31 g/L.【Conclusion】When the inoculation amount was 7%, the dry mass of the mycelial bulb was 6.31 g/L after 15 days of culture, which could be directly used in the next step of production and greatly shortened the seed production cycle of V. brumalis. |
